1. What is Net Pay?

Net pay, often called "take-home pay", is the amount of money you actually receive after all deductions have been made from your gross salary. These deductions typically include income tax, National Insurance contributions, and possibly student loan repayments and pension contributions.

5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: How often should I calculate my net pay?
A: You should recalculate whenever your salary changes, tax codes are updated, or your deduction amounts change.

Q2: Why is my net pay different from my colleague's with the same gross pay?
A: Differences can occur due to different tax codes, student loan plans, pension contribution rates, or other voluntary deductions.

Q3: Are bonuses included in gross pay?
A: Yes, bonuses and other taxable benefits should be included in your gross pay calculation.
